2026 Lexus LC 500

2026 Lexus
LC 500

Lexus keeps the LC focused for 2026 by saying farewell to the LC 500h hybrid while still offering the robust power of a naturally aspirated V8 engine. With a zero-to-60-mph time of just 4.4 seconds, this flagship coupe roars into the new model year. Most significantly, the Inspiration Series has been reintroduced for the LC coupe in a limited North American run of 200 units. Lexus has also expanded standard technology by including Intuitive Parking Assist, a semi-autonomous parking system, on this grand tourer. In addition, a refreshed exterior palette adds Smoke Matte Gray to the list of choices.

Trim and Powertrain

The LC 500 coupe comes in a single premium trim package. It’s outfitted with a 471-horsepower 5.0-liter engine linked to rear wheels via a ten-speed automatic transmission. The advanced gearbox is managed through a center console shift knob or steering wheel-mounted magnesium paddles. The engine audibly comes to life through a tuned active exhaust, giving the LC its throaty note and engaging character. According to the EPA’s official estimations, the fuel economy is 16 mpg around town and 24 mpg on the highway.

Standard Features and Optional Packages

The LC’s grand tourer platform is reinforced by an adaptive variable suspension, a drive-mode selector, aluminum pedals, and performance-inspired instrumentation. Leather upholstery underscores the luxury factor, as do heated and ventilated front seats with eight-way power control, a glass roof with a sunshade, and LED exterior lighting. The LC is also equipped with dual-zone automatic climate control, proximity keyless entry, push-button ignition, USB ports, and 21-inch staggered-width alloy wheels.



The model’s optional groupings include the All-Weather Package (a heated steering wheel and a windshield wiper de-icer); the Touring Package (semi-aniline leather upholstery, an Alcantara headliner, upgraded audio, and the All-Weather Package); and the Sport Package (Alcantara-trimmed front and rear sport seats, rear performance dampers, a Torsen limited-slip differential, and performance brake pads). The Dynamic Handling Package adds active rear steering, variable gear-ratio steering, a speed-activated rear wing, an Alcantara headliner, a carbon-fiber roof, and carbon-fiber scuff plates. For LC buyers looking for an even more unique ride, the Lexus Bespoke Build program offers tailored selections (wheels, sport seats, a carbon-fiber roof, and exterior and interior treatments) along with an interior badge and certificate of authenticity.



The 2026 LC 500 Inspiration Series layers in Smoke Matte Gray paint, a carbon-fiber roof, forged 21-inch matte black wheels, and blacked-out exterior accents. Inside, white-and-black styling sets the tone, while the equipment list grows with active rear steering, a heated steering wheel, a head-up display, upgraded audio, special scuff plates, front bumper canards, a carbon-fiber rear fixed spoiler, red brake calipers, and an exclusive center-console badge.

Advanced Driver Aids and Safety Technology

The LC hosts the comprehensive Lexus Safety System+ 2.5 with forward collision warning, automatic emergency braking with pedestrian detection, lane departure alert with steering assist, adaptive cruise control with lane-tracing assist, road sign recognition, and automatic high beams. Blind-spot monitoring, rear cross-traffic alert, parking sensors, semi-autonomous parking assistance, and a surround-view monitor are also on the list. The fundamental safety equipment for this elegant coupe includes eight airbags, anti-lock brakes, stability control, traction control, and a rearview monitor with dynamic guidelines.

Infotainment and Connectivity

A 12.3-inch touchscreen defines the LC 500’s infotainment system. This platform has wireless smartphone connectivity (Android Auto and Apple CarPlay), SiriusXM satellite radio, Bluetooth, Wi-Fi hotspot capability, and access to Lexus Connected Services for cloud-based navigation, emergency help, and remote functions. The default audio scenario has 12 speakers, while the Touring Package and Inspiration Series options upgrade to a 13-speaker Mark Levinson setup.
